正则表达式后面的g是什么意思?g80代码什么意思

发布时间:2023-11-30 18:01:20
发布者:网友

各位老铁们好,相信很多人对正则表达式后面的g是什么意思都不是特别的了解,因此呢,今天就来为大家分享下关于正则表达式后面的g是什么意思以及g80代码什么意思的问题知识,还望可以帮助大家,解决大家的一些困惑,下面一起来看看吧!

一、UBB是什么意思

1、UBB,是指论坛中的替代HTML代码的安全代码。

2、这种代码使用正则表达式来进行匹配,不同的论坛所使用的UBB代码很可能不同,不能一概而论。UBB代码的出现,使得论坛可以使用类似HTML的标签来增加文字的属性,同时又不用害怕HTML代码中所夹带的不良信息!

二、g80代码什么意思

G代码解释器是全软件式数控系统的重要模块。数控机床通常使用G代码来描述机床的加工信息,如走刀轨迹、坐标的选择、冷却液的开启等,将G代码解释为数控系统能够识别的数据块是G代码解释器的主要功能。G代码解释器的开放性也是设计和实现中必须要考虑的问题。

在G代码解释器中,对G代码进行关键字分解是骨架,,对代码进行分组则是进行语法检查的基础。王心光等人在虚拟数控加工仿真中使用Microsoft的GRETA正则类库,解决了G代码关键词分解问题。

三、perl正则表达式|顺序

1、perl正则表达式([a-z]{1})\.替换成$1

2、#!/usr/bin/perl

$string='q.';

四、pg和xg有什么区别

PG和XG在工作机制和精度方面有所区别。

1.PG是按照时序模型进行逐步预测产生一个个目标点,相对来说在对不稳定点的处理和复杂场景的处理上更具优势,但是它的预测精度相对于其他方法略有欠缺。

2.XG是一种正则化的GBDT框架,通过把所有模型组合成一个ensemble模型,每个模型都只对几个样本点做出非常准确的预测,最终输出平均作为预测结果,确保预测精度很高。

但是它对于场景复杂度和数据量要求比较高。

因此,如果需要在精度和时间效率上取得平衡,需要根据任务场景的不同选择两个模型之一,或者结合两种模型进行集成预测。

五、ue表达式使用方法

1.去掉文本中包含某特定字符串的行(请细细体会一下,这个很常用,类似Vim中的“:g/pattern/d”功能)

CTRL+R-->点选"正则表达式"-->“查找内容”输入“%*输入您要删除的行包含的字符串*^p”-->“替换为”空,什么都不输入-->点击“全部替换”-->OK搞定!

解释一下:“%”在UE的正则表达式中表示行首,“*”表示0或任意多的字符,“^p”是DOS文件类型的换行符(Unix类型文件的换行符是^n,MAC(Apple)类型文件的换行符号为^r,在使用换行符的时候这里要注意一下)。所以含义不言自明。

CTRL+R-->点选"正则表达式"-->“查找内容”输入“++$”-->“替换为”空,什么都不输入-->点击“全部替换”-->OK搞定!

使用UE自带的功能(UE)已经想到你可能总使用这样的功能啦:右键-->点击“格式”-->点击“删除行尾空格”

CTRL+R-->点选"正则表达式"-->“查找内容”输入“^p$”-->“替换为”空,什么都不输入-->点击“全部替换”-->OK搞定!

CTRL+R-->点选"正则表达式"-->“查找内容”输入“^p^p”-->“替换为”输入“^p”-->点击“全部替换”-->OK搞定!

如果你还想了解更多这方面的信息,记得收藏关注本站。

——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用

小炎智能写作